Home | History | Annotate | Download | only in inputflinger

Lines Matching full:deviceid

74     int32_t deviceId;
188 virtual uint32_t getDeviceClasses(int32_t deviceId) const = 0;
190 virtual InputDeviceIdentifier getDeviceIdentifier(int32_t deviceId) const = 0;
192 virtual int32_t getDeviceControllerNumber(int32_t deviceId) const = 0;
194 virtual void getConfiguration(int32_t deviceId, PropertyMap* outConfiguration) const = 0;
196 virtual status_t getAbsoluteAxisInfo(int32_t deviceId, int axis,
199 virtual bool hasRelativeAxis(int32_t deviceId, int axis) const = 0;
201 virtual bool hasInputProperty(int32_t deviceId, int property) const = 0;
203 virtual status_t mapKey(int32_t deviceId,
207 virtual status_t mapAxis(int32_t deviceId, int32_t scanCode,
231 virtual int32_t getScanCodeState(int32_t deviceId, int32_t scanCode) const = 0;
232 virtual int32_t getKeyCodeState(int32_t deviceId, int32_t keyCode) const = 0;
233 virtual int32_t getSwitchState(int32_t deviceId, int32_t sw) const = 0;
234 virtual status_t getAbsoluteAxisValue(int32_t deviceId, int32_t axis,
240 virtual bool markSupportedKeyCodes(int32_t deviceId, size_t numCodes, const int32_t* keyCodes,
243 virtual bool hasScanCode(int32_t deviceId, int32_t scanCode) const = 0;
246 virtual bool hasLed(int32_t deviceId, int32_t led) const = 0;
247 virtual void setLedState(int32_t deviceId, int32_t led, bool on) = 0;
249 virtual void getVirtualKeyDefinitions(int32_t deviceId,
252 virtual sp<KeyCharacterMap> getKeyCharacterMap(int32_t deviceId) const = 0;
253 virtual bool setKeyboardLayoutOverlay(int32_t deviceId, const sp<KeyCharacterMap>& map) = 0;
256 virtual void vibrate(int32_t deviceId, nsecs_t duration) = 0;
257 virtual void cancelVibrate(int32_t deviceId) = 0;
277 virtual uint32_t getDeviceClasses(int32_t deviceId) const;
279 virtual InputDeviceIdentifier getDeviceIdentifier(int32_t deviceId) const;
281 virtual int32_t getDeviceControllerNumber(int32_t deviceId) const;
283 virtual void getConfiguration(int32_t deviceId, PropertyMap* outConfiguration) const;
285 virtual status_t getAbsoluteAxisInfo(int32_t deviceId, int axis,
288 virtual bool hasRelativeAxis(int32_t deviceId, int axis) const;
290 virtual bool hasInputProperty(int32_t deviceId, int property) const;
292 virtual status_t mapKey(int32_t deviceId,
296 virtual status_t mapAxis(int32_t deviceId, int32_t scanCode,
301 virtual int32_t getScanCodeState(int32_t deviceId, int32_t scanCode) const;
302 virtual int32_t getKeyCodeState(int32_t deviceId, int32_t keyCode) const;
303 virtual int32_t getSwitchState(int32_t deviceId, int32_t sw) const;
304 virtual status_t getAbsoluteAxisValue(int32_t deviceId, int32_t axis, int32_t* outValue) const;
306 virtual bool markSupportedKeyCodes(int32_t deviceId, size_t numCodes,
311 virtual bool hasScanCode(int32_t deviceId, int32_t scanCode) const;
312 virtual bool hasLed(int32_t deviceId, int32_t led) const;
313 virtual void setLedState(int32_t deviceId, int32_t led, bool on);
315 virtual void getVirtualKeyDefinitions(int32_t deviceId,
318 virtual sp<KeyCharacterMap> getKeyCharacterMap(int32_t deviceId) const;
319 virtual bool setKeyboardLayoutOverlay(int32_t deviceId, const sp<KeyCharacterMap>& map);
321 virtual void vibrate(int32_t deviceId, nsecs_t duration);
322 virtual void cancelVibrate(int32_t deviceId);
398 Device* getDeviceLocked(int32_t deviceId) const;